ऋग्वेद १.१०५.१
Ṛgveda 1.105.1
ca̱ndramā̍ a̱psva1̱̍ntarā su̍pa̱rṇo dhā̍vate di̱vi |na vo̍ hiraṇyanemayaḥ pa̱daṃ vi̍ndanti vidyuto vi̱ttaṃ me̍ a̱sya ro̍dasī ||
Transliteration IAST
ca̱ndramā̍ a̱psva1̱̍ntarā su̍pa̱rṇo dhā̍vate di̱vi | na vo̍ hiraṇyanemayaḥ pa̱daṃ vi̍ndanti vidyuto vi̱ttaṃ me̍ a̱sya ro̍dasī ||
Padapāṭha word by word, as recited
चन्द्रमाः | अप्-सु | अन्तः | आ | सु-पर्णः | धावते | दिवि | न | वः | हिरण्य-नेमयः | पदम् | विन्दन्ति | वि-द्युतः | वित्तम् | मे | अस्य | रोदसी इति
candramāḥ | ap-su | antaḥ | ā | su-parṇaḥ | dhāvate | divi | na | vaḥ | hiraṇya-nemayaḥ | padam | vindanti | vi-dyutaḥ | vittam | me | asya | rodasī iti
Translations signed
WITHIN the waters runs the Moon, he with the beauteous wings in heaven. Ye lightnings with your golden wheels, men find not your abiding-place. Mark this my woe, ye Earth and Heaven.
